Tom Lee's BitMine Just Bought $151 Million Worth of Ethereum During the Dip — Here's What That Signals
86d ago · 1 source
BitMine, a company associated with prominent market strategist Tom Lee, has purchased $151 million worth of Ethereum during a recent price decline. The firm described the move as an 'attractive opportunity,' signaling strong institutional confidence in ETH's long-term value despite short-term price weakness.
WHY IT MATTERS
Imagine a well-known, respected investor walks into a store during a big sale and buys $151 million worth of a product they believe will be worth much more later. That's essentially what happened here. Tom Lee is a famous Wall Street strategist, and his company just bought a massive amount of Ethereum while its price was down. When big players with deep pockets and research teams make moves like this, it often signals they see long-term value that everyday investors might be missing. For beginners, this is a good example of 'buying the dip' — a strategy where investors purchase assets when prices fall, betting on a future rebound. It doesn't guarantee the price will go up, but it does show that serious money is flowing into Ethereum.
